indian_summer_bookwright_joeIndia is hot, and not just in July. The subcontinent is being “re-discovered” by Western filmmakers in the wake of “Slumdog Millionaire.” Director Joe Wright (pictured), whose versions of “Atonement” and “Pride and Prejudice” were widely praised, has signed on to directIndian Summer.” Project is based on the book of the same name by Alex von Tunzelmann about the last days of Britain’s colonial rule in India and the symbolic end of Great Britain’s status as a world superpower.
